Steps to make Focaccia with Rosemary and Romano:
  1. Coat inside of crockpot with nonstick cooking spray. Combine water,yeast and sugar in small bowl;let stand 5 minutes until frothy.
  2. Combine flour,rosemary,saltine red pepper flakes in large bowl;stir to blend. Pour water mixture and oil into flour mixture;stir until soft dough forms. Turn dough out onto lightly floured surface;kneed 5 minutes. Place dough in crockpot stretch to fir bottom. Cover;let stand 1 hour in warm place (85f) until double in size.
  3. Gently press dough with fingertips to deflate. Sprinkle with cheese. Cover let rise 30 minutes. Place clean dry towel over top of crockpot then replace lid.
  4. Cover;cook on high 2 hours or until dough is lightly browned on sides. Remove to wire rack. Let stand 10 to 15 minutes before slicing.
